Enterococcus hirae belongs in the Enterococcus faecium group within the genus Enterococcus. This species occurs naturally in the environment, commensally in the alimentary tracts of animals, and pathologically for example in humans with urinary infections. Some strains of E. hirae possess virulence factors, including biofilm formation. Biofilm growth protects bacteria against host de- fences; biofilm can be a source of persistent infection. Testing bacterial strains for their ability to form biofilm might therefore facilitate their treatment or prevention. This study focuses on bio- film formation by E. hirae strains derived from various animals. This kind of testing has never been done before. A total of 64 identified E. hirae from laying hens, ducks, pheasants, ostriches, rabbits, horses and a goat were tested by means of three methods; using Congo red agar, the tube method and microtiter plate agar. The majority of strains were found to form biofilm. 62.5% of strains were biofilm-forming, four categorized as highly positive (OD570 ≥1); most strains were low-grade biofilm positive (0.1 ≤ OD 570 < 1). Related to poultry, 55 E. hirae strains were tested nd found to produce biofilm; 24 strains did not form biofilm, 31 strains were biofilm-forming; 27 strains showed low-grade biofilm formation, and four strains were highly biofilm-forming. Four strains from hens and ostriches reached the highest OD570 values, more than 0.500. Rabbit-derived E. hirae strains as well as strains isolated from horses and the goat were low-grade bio- film-forming. Microtiter plate assay proved to be the best tool for testing the in vitro biofilm for- mation capacity of E. hirae strains from different species of animals.

Introduction: Effective and safe anesthesia for rodents has long been a leading concern among biomedical researchers. Intraperitoneal injection constitutes an alternative to inhalant anesthesia.
Purpose: The aim of this study was to identify a safe, reliable, and effective anesthesia and postoperative analgesia protocol for laboratory rats exposed to painful procedures.
Material and methods: Twenty-seven female Wistar rats in an ongoing study that required surgery were randomized into groups for three different intraperitoneal anesthesia protocols and three different analgesia regimens. The anesthesia groups were (1) medetomidine + ketamine (MK), (2) ketamine + xylacine (KX), and (3) fentanyl + medetomidine (FM). Three analgesia groups were equally distributed among the anesthesia groups: (1) local mepivacaine + oral ibuprofen (MI), (2) oral tramadol + oral ibuprofen (TI), and (3) local tramadol + oral tramadol + oral ibuprofen (TTI). A core was assigned to measure anesthesia (0-3) and analgesia (0-2) effectiveness; the lower the score, the more effective the treatment.
Results: The mean MK score was 0.44 versus 2.00 for FM and 2.33 for KX. Mean score for analgesia on the first postoperative day was TTI (4.66) TI (9.13), and MI (10.14). Mean score 48 hours after surgery was TTI (3.4), TI (6.71), and MI (9.5). These differences were statistically significant.
Conclusion: MK was shown to be a reliable, safe, and effective method of anesthesia. The TTI analgesia regimen is strongly recommended in light of these results.
The aim of the study was to evaluate the visualization of the rabbit common calcanean tendon and adjacent structures in the high-field magnetic resonance imaging (MRI) of 1.5 T field strength and to compare the results with those previously obtained for the low-field MRI (0.25 T). Eight New Zealand rabbits were used in the post-mortem study and the results indicate that the high-field MRI provides more detailed images only in transverse scans, where the outer outline of the tendon was visualized more accurately. Other analysed structures were imaged with a resolution comparable to the low-field MRI.
The presence of lipopolysaccharide (LPS) in blood induces an inflammatory response which leads to multiple organ dysfunction and numerous metabolic disorders. Uncontrolled, improper or late intervention may lead to tissue hypoxia, anaerobic glycolysis and a disturbance in the acid -base balance. The effects of LPS-induced toxemia on biological and immunological markers were well studied. However, parameters such as base excess, ions, and acid-base balance were not fully investigated. Therefore, the objective of this study was to examine these blood parameters collectively in LPS-induced inflammatory toxemia in rat’s model. After induction of toxemia by injecting LPS at a rate of 5 mg/kg body weight intravenously, blood was collected from the tail vein of twenty rats and immediately analyzed. After 24 hours, the animals were sacrificed and the blood was collected from the caudal vena cava. The results revealed that the levels of pH, bicarbonate, partial pressure of oxygen, oxygen saturation, Alveolar oxygen, hemoglobin, hematocrit, magnesium (Mg2+), and calcium (Ca2+) were significantly decreased. On the other side, the levels of Base excess blood, Base excess extracellular fluid, partial pressure of carbon dioxide, lactate, Ca2+/Mg2+, potassium, and chloride were significantly increased compared to those found pre toxemia induction. However, sodium level showed no significant change. In conclusion, Acute LPS-toxemia model disturbs acid-base balance, blood gases, and ions. These parameters can be used to monitor human and animal toxemic inflammatory response induced by bacterial LPS conditions to assist in the management of the diagnosed cases.

The article is an attempted analysis of the literary genre of fable as a case study of a selection of fables by Lyudmila Petrushevskaya. In particular, the analysis focuses on the fable cycles: The New Adventures of Helen the Beautiful, Adventures of Barbie and Wild Animal Fables. The perspective adopted in the article focuses mainly on the axiological aspect of the fables and the reconstruction of their moral message. The moral sense in Petrushevskaya’s fables is veiled under their overt sense. Even the overt sense is hidden deeply under the multiple levels of “intertextual irony” (Eco). The analysis also explores the links between Petrushevskaya’s works, folk magical fairy tales and the prototypical genre of the classical Russian fable. The innovative fables created by Petrushevskaya de-conventionalize the classical schemata of the genre, and as such they constitute an ironic, mocking and sometimes a bitter commentary on the contemporary world. The fables exhibit a high degree of “poetics of everyday life” – a merger of popular and high culture. They both recreate and at the same time mock the schemata and rituals of pop culture, also displaying noticeable feminist tones. In their poetics, the fables employ cyclic and serial arrangement, and are completed with “words of wisdom” that are far from naïve moral judgements.
Five years ago, the Act on the protection of animals used for scientific or educational purposes entered into force. It is the implementation of Directive 2010/63/ EU into the Polish legal system. During the work on the Directive, most scientists were convinced that the previous Act on animal experiments of 2005 was in line with the new EU law and only minor modifications would be necessary. Legislators, however, decided to create a completely new legal act. Already at the time of the Act's creation, the scientific community made many critical comments regarding the law. Significant discrepancies between the Directive and the proposed provisions of the Act were far more stringent, and in many places with imprecise provisions which could have resulted in difficulties in conducting research using animals. Unfortunately, most of the postulates of the scientific community were not considered at that time. What does the Act look like 5 years after its adoption? Instead of a transparent and balanced law modeled on the EU Directive, which provides real protection for experimental animals, while safeguarding the intellectual rights of animal testing units, a patch of underdeveloped, sometimes mutually exclusive provisions has been issued. Instead of raising the welfare of the animals used for research to a higher level, it significantly increased the costs of operating research units and increased bureaucracy. Instead of rationalizing the system of issuing consents for research, it has been weakened and entangled in administrative and legal disputes without the provision of basic administrative facilities. Instead of increasing the international mobility of scientists and technicians working with experimental animals, the implementation of the law created a training “system” that is not recognized in any other EU country. In the light of the 5-year experience of the scientific community and the expert part of the composition of local ethics committees, we postulate to introduce a number of significant changes to the act so that its amended version actually ensures animal protection, respect for researchers and returns to the current of European legislation.
